The Building Commissioner is also responsible for the management of the Building Department and the oversight of building/facility operations. Duties The position is responsible for the administrative and technical enforcement of the Massachusetts Building Code, local zoning laws, and related ordinances. Key duties include reviewing and processing building permit applications, conducting inspections of construction and renovation projects, investigating code violations, and issuing Certificates of Occupancy. The role oversees the maintenance of City Hall facilities, supervises departmental staff including inspectors and clerical personnel, manages payroll and budgets, and prepares reports. The position also plays a key role in developing department policies and recommending permit and license fees. Additional duties may be assigned by the Mayor.
Requirements and Qualifications:
Proficiency in Microsoft Windows and related software applications. Strong communication skills for interaction with the public, city officials, and staff. Valid motor vehicle operator's license. Supervisory experience required. Bachelor's degree in building construction, design, or a related field - or five (5) years of experience in building construction/design supervision, or an equivalent combination of education and experience. General knowledge of building materials, construction standards, fire prevention, accessibility, ventilation, and egress requirements. Familiarity with M.G.L. c. 32 §13A and associated accessibility regulations. In-depth knowledge of the 2015 International Building Code and the Massachusetts Energy Stretch Code. Certification as a Building Commissioner by the Massachusetts Board of Building Regulations and Standards (BBRS) as required under 780 CMR R7.
